Kyushu University completed a ‘Stricter Selection of Focus’ for all graduate schools in April 2000 and, at the same time, we have introduced a graduate school and research institution system. The purpose is to separate the system into both an “educational school” and a “research institution”, where individual staff can belong to appropriate teaching and research divisions, allowing for more flexible cooperation between staff.
As a result, we have created: an undergraduate “school” for education which performs both education and research duties, a graduate “school” which performs graduate education, and a “faculty” which performs research duties.
